About Loma Mar, CA
Loma Mar is a small community in California with a population of 319 residents. The median household income is $250,001 per year, which is above the national average. The median age in Loma Mar is 46.9 years.
Housing in Loma Mar has a median home value of $1,020,800 and median monthly rent of $0. Of the 135 total housing units, the majority are owner-occupied, with 110 owner-occupied and 25 renter-occupied units.
